Any Atari 8-bit computer users in the DFW, Texas or surrounding areas interested in getting together for an old school "user group" style meet-up?
 
Saturday, August 28th - 6pm till ??? at the National Videogame Museum in Frisco, TX.
 
Product demos, buy/sell/trade, repair and upgrade workshop? Drop me a PM, respond here, or head to the event page on FB.
